P0201 is an OBD-II diagnostic trouble code meaning “Injector Circuit/Open - Cylinder 1.” P0201 means the engine computer detected an electrical problem in the wiring or control circuit for the fuel injector on cylinder 1. The PCM pulses each injector open and back ground, and when it sees an open circuit, a short, or abnormal resistance on cylinder 1's injector circuit, it sets this code. In practice it means cylinder 1 may not be getting fuel injected properly, which can cause a misfire, rough running, or a no-start on that cylinder. It points to the injector itself or its wiring, not to a fuel-pressure problem affecting the whole engine. Common Causes

1Damaged or corroded injector connector or terminals at cylinder 1
2Broken, chafed, or shorted injector wiring harness
3Failed (open or shorted) fuel injector on cylinder 1
4Loose or poor ground/power feed to the injector circuit
5Blown injector fuse or relay feeding the bank
6Failed injector driver inside the PCM/ECM
